As a general rule, if the owner hired whoever drafted the construction plans, or if whoever drafted the faulty plans is an employee or agent of the owner, it is the owner who will be liable for defective plans.
Construction defects include improperly designed materials, poor workmanship, and failure to follow construction codes. Any deficiency in a building project can be considered a construction defect, including: Defective architectural designs. Lack of planning or supervision.
Common Types of Construction Defects Water leaks are by far the most common construction defect. ... Another common issue is foundation movement. ... Concrete that is cracking, scaling, or spalling may cause issues to nearby property or may require premature replacement.
A construction defect is any physical condition that reduces the value of a structure or endangers the health or safety of its occupants, that is a result of a flaw in design, materials, or workmanship, and that is not the result of normal aging or wear and tear.
There are generally four categories of construction defects: construction deficiencies, design deficiencies, material deficiencies, and subsurface deficiencies.

Such as failure due to poor quality workmanship, which can result in a range of damages. Improper plumbing work causing leaks that might promote mold growth or damage electrical wires in a wall is an example.
Generally, a defect under a construction contract is work which is not performed in ance with the requirements of the construction contract. To assess what a defect is requires an examination of the terms of the contract to understand what was required of the contractor.
